Leaky and 3 brooms was decent food..tasty and a variety.

I would strongly recommend not getting the food at the Moe's Tavern food court area. We had the Waffle Chicken sandwich and it was nasty. The flaming moe drink was equally gross. You may like it if you like McDonalds grade food though....hahaha.

@ Leaky Cauldron...Fish 'n' Chips, Soup in a bread bowl was good.
@ 3Brooms...we have the family feast platter....a little of everything...was good too.

Enjoy...October has typically great weather to go to Orlando.
